你当前正在访问 Microsoft Azure Global Edition 技术文档网站。 如果需要访问由世纪互联运营的 Microsoft Azure 中国技术文档网站,请访问 https://docs.azure.cn。
TokenCredentialOptions interface
提供用于配置标识库如何向Microsoft Entra ID发出身份验证请求的选项。
- Extends
属性
authority |
用于身份验证请求的颁发机构主机。 可以通过 AzureAuthorityHosts 获取可能的值。 默认为 "https://login.microsoftonline.com"。 |
logging |
允许用户配置日志记录策略选项的设置,允许记录帐户信息和个人身份信息,以便客户支持。 |
继承属性
additional |
要包含在 HTTP 管道中的其他策略。 |
allow |
如果请求是通过 HTTP 而不是 HTTPS 发送的,则设置为 true |
http |
将用于发送 HTTP 请求的 HttpClient。 |
proxy |
用于为传出请求配置代理的选项。 |
redirect |
有关如何处理重定向响应的选项。 |
retry |
控制如何重试失败请求的选项。 |
telemetry |
用于将常见遥测和跟踪信息设置为传出请求的选项。 |
tls |
用于配置 TLS 身份验证的选项 |
user |
用于将用户代理详细信息添加到传出请求的选项。 |
属性详细信息
authorityHost
用于身份验证请求的颁发机构主机。 可以通过 AzureAuthorityHosts 获取可能的值。 默认为 "https://login.microsoftonline.com"。
authorityHost?: string
属性值
string
loggingOptions
允许用户配置日志记录策略选项的设置,允许记录帐户信息和个人身份信息,以便客户支持。
loggingOptions?: LogPolicyOptions & { allowLoggingAccountIdentifiers?: boolean, enableUnsafeSupportLogging?: boolean }
属性值
LogPolicyOptions & { allowLoggingAccountIdentifiers?: boolean, enableUnsafeSupportLogging?: boolean }
继承属性详细信息
additionalPolicies
要包含在 HTTP 管道中的其他策略。
additionalPolicies?: AdditionalPolicyConfig[]
属性值
继承自 CommonClientOptions.additionalPolicies
allowInsecureConnection
如果请求是通过 HTTP 而不是 HTTPS 发送的,则设置为 true
allowInsecureConnection?: boolean
属性值
boolean
继承自 CommonClientOptions.allowInsecureConnection
httpClient
将用于发送 HTTP 请求的 HttpClient。
httpClient?: HttpClient
属性值
继承自 CommonClientOptions.httpClient
proxyOptions
redirectOptions
有关如何处理重定向响应的选项。
redirectOptions?: RedirectPolicyOptions
属性值
继承自 CommonClientOptions.redirectOptions
retryOptions
控制如何重试失败请求的选项。
retryOptions?: PipelineRetryOptions
属性值
继承自 CommonClientOptions.retryOptions
telemetryOptions
用于将常见遥测和跟踪信息设置为传出请求的选项。
telemetryOptions?: TelemetryOptions
属性值
继承自 CommonClientOptions.telemetryOptions
tlsOptions
userAgentOptions
用于将用户代理详细信息添加到传出请求的选项。
userAgentOptions?: UserAgentPolicyOptions
属性值
继承自 CommonClientOptions.userAgentOptions